Wanted Suspect Barricades Himself Inside Stafford County Home (Update) A wanted suspect surrendered peacefully after barricading himself inside of a Stafford County home, police said. Deputies in Stafford County were notified that the suspect, whose name was not released, was in a home on Edwards Drive around 11 a.m. Thursday, Oct. 26, Major Shawn Kimmitz said. Deputies surrounded the home, but the man refused to leave. K9 and drone teams were called to the scene, and the man ultimately surrendered peacefully sometime around noon. K9 Tracks Thief Who Plowed Stolen Car Into Lorton Home (Update) A 32-year-old man who plowed a vehicle into an occupied Fairfax County home while fleeing from officers early Thursday, Sept. 7, was tracked down by a police K9, authorities said. Nico Anthony Doublet was being held without bond on charges of Trespassing, Auto Theft, and Hit and Run, county police said.
